    I am so excited, so motivated after my first week on Fast BSD. Basically within a week I have lost 5.1kg/11.2 lbs, there have been no symptoms of acid reflux – which has been plaguing me for weeks, and I feel a lot more energetic. I realize the weight loss won’t be as high as the weeks go past, but it’s great to see that it works.

    I did have a bit of a headache at the start of week but now it’s gone.

    I haven’t done a lot of exercise, which I will amp up this week.

    Meal examples:

    B – poached egg with tomato/avocado/mushrooms
    L – Salads. For the first half of the week I had a Mediterranean salad with tuna, lately I have been a pulled pork salad with spinach, coriander, tomato and pumpkin seeds.
    D – Protein (salmon steak/cutlets/grilled chicken breast) with salad.

    Compared to another diet I went on, that was 1200 calories and meal planned, I haven’t been starving and have already had better results.
